RFH-SGA scheme for determining nutritional status in patients with cirrhosis. Patients are categorized in relation to their BMI, MAMC, and dietary intake into one of three categories: adequately nourished, moderately malnourished (or suspected to be), and severely malnourished. A subjective override based on factors such as profound recent weight loss or recent significant improvements in appetite and dietary intake can be used to modify the patient's classification.
From: Morgan MY, Madden AM, Soulsby CT, Morris RW. Derivation and validation of a new global method for assessing nutritional status in patients with cirrhosis. Hepatology 2006; 44:823.
